100% dimensionally interchangeable with Durco (Flowserve) Mark III -- Group I, II, and III frames. Reverse vane impeller design reduces axial thrust and seal chamber pressure.
External impeller adjustment mechanism -- the industry most innovative design. Allows fast, accurate impeller clearance setting without pump disassembly.
Full wet-end alloy coverage: Hastelloy C-276, Titanium Pd7B, CD4MCuN duplex, CN7M Alloy 20, Nickel, Zirconium. 20-40% cost savings vs OEM with identical performance.

Application Chemical processing, petrochemical refining, corrosive chemical transfer, pulp & paper mill liquors, reverse vane impeller applications, high-temperature services, MRO replacement programs, EPC project procurement
Flow Rate Up to 7,500 GPM (1,703 m3/h)
Head Range Up to 990 ft (302 m)
Temperature -73 degrees C to 370 degrees C (-100 degrees F to 700 degrees F)
Materials CF8M (316SS), CD4MCuN (Duplex), CN7M (Alloy 20), WCB (Carbon Steel), Hastelloy B, Hastelloy C-276, Nickel 200, Titanium Grade Pd7B, Zirconium 702
Pressure Rating Up to 27 bar (400 PSIG)

Product Summary

Type: Single stage, horizontal, overhung, end suction, centerline discharge, back pull-out, fully compliant with ASME B73.1-2001

Available Sizes and Range of Service

The Mark 3 line covers a broad hydraulic range:

• Sizes – 30

– Group 1 – 7

– Group 2 – 16

– Group 3 – 7

• Capacities

– 60 Hz to 1680 m3/h (7400 gpm)

– 50 Hz to 1390 m3/h (6120 gpm)

• Heads

– 60 Hz to 300 m (985 ft)

– 50 Hz to 200 m (655 ft)

Construction Features

There is a very high degree of interchangeability in the Mark 3 family. The 30 sizes that comprise the family are built with only three different power frames. The charts at right summarize the interchangeability.
